Silt deposition occurs in the downstream approach channel of the tidal lock as in a closed channel or excavated dock basin. It is often difficult to calculate or predict siltation because of complex flow and sediment conditions and many other affecting factors. In this paper, the characteristics of flow movement in the approach channel (including its mouth) of the tidal lock are analyzed, the basic laws of sediment movement and siltation mechanism are investigated, the conditions for three types of siltation (circumfluence siltation, density flow siltation and slow flow siltation) are discussed, and corresponding calculating formulas are proposed. A practical example shows that the difference between measured and calculated results is small, indicating that the present calculating methods could be used in design and management of practical engineering projects. 展开更多

The variation of the amplitude of waves with varying incident angles when waves propagate through a typical approach channel is discussed by a numerical calculation method, the result of which shows that the influence of the channel on wave propagation is obvious. When the wave propagation direction is in coincidence with the channel axis, the wave amplitude ratio will decrease with the increase of propagation distance. When the incident angle is 15 - 30 , there appears an area of larger wave amplitude ratio on the side slope facing the waves, but at the another side, the wave amplitude ratio is generally small, indicating that the channel has a shielding effect. When waves propagate across the channel perpendicularly, the wave amplitude ratio can be calculated with the shallow water coefficient. 展开更多

The Langevin approach has been applied to model the random open and closing dynamics of ion channels. It has long been known that the gate-based Langevin approach is not sufficiently accurate to reproduce the statistics of stochastic channel dynamics in Hodgkin–Huxley neurons. Here, we introduce a modified gate-based Langevin approach with rescaled noise strength to simulate stochastic channel dynamics. The rescaled independent gate and identical gate Langevin approaches improve the statistical results for the mean membrane voltage, inter-spike interval, and spike amplitude. 展开更多

Zooplankton plays an important role in aquatic food webs by fluxing of energy from primary producer to subsequent trophic levels in the food chain. The annual pattern of zooplankton communities and potential environmental drivers were studied in the Kohelia channel, Bangladesh from summer 2014 to spring 2015.Samples were collected using net at a depth of 1 m. A total of 32 species belonged to 18 orders, 27 families and 15 taxonomic groups were identified. Of these species, 22 distributed in all four seasons of which 8 were dominant and highly contributing to the total communities. Species number peaked in summer next to winter and fall in spring while maximum abundance was in summer and minimum in spring. Multivariate analyses showed that there was a clear annual pattern in the zooplankton communities. Species diversity and evenness peaked in spring but fall in autumn while the high value of species richness was found in winter. Biological-environmental best matching(BIO-ENV) analyses conformed that community pattern of zooplankton was mainly driven by transparency salinity, and temperature individually or combined with water nutrients. These results demonstrate that annual pattern of the zooplankton community shaped by channel environmental factors in subtropical channel ecosystems, thus might be used for community-based subtropical coastal water bioassessment. 展开更多

A semi-blind channel estimation algorithm based on subspace approach for orthogonal frequency division multiplexing(OFDM) systems over the frequency-selective channel is proposed. A linear preeoding is applied on each block before the IFFT operation and a low-rank structure is created in the received signal. Then subspace properties can be exploited to identify the channel up to a scalar ambiguity. The residual scalar ambiguities eliminated by inserting pilots into data stream. Simulation results illustrate the performance of the proposed semi-blind algorithm. 展开更多

Background The retrograde approach allows to significantly increase the success rate of coronary chronic total occlusion(CTO) percutaneous intervention(PCI). Epicardial collateral channels(CCs) remain an essential channel for retro-recanalization. But paucity of data in this area limits the use of epicardial CCs for retrograde canalization. The present study was to explore the feasibility and significance of coronary epicardial collaterals for the retrograde approach treatment of coronary CTO. Methods We retrospectively analyzed 347 CTO cases which the retrograde approach was attempted after reviewing the coronary angiograms of 1290 patients. And there were 89 retrograde approach PCI cases applying epicardial CCs. We collected the clinical and angiography data of those patents for analyzing the safety and usefulness of this technology. Results The study consisted of347 CTO PCI. Mean age was 60.8±10.4 and 60.3±10.2 years in epicardial CCs and septal CCs groups respectively. The total retrograde success rate was 79.8%. The success rate of retrograde approach applying epicardial CCs was not lower(82.0% vs. 79.1%, P=0.646) than that in cases applying septal CCs. There were 8 epicardial CCs injury cases(9.0%) and 3 cases resulted in cardiac tamponade and required emergency pericardiocentesis. Coils were used for all of them with success. No patients were dead in retrograde approach applying epicardial CCS.Conclusions Coronary epicardial collaterals can be used as an access for the retrograde approach in the percutaneous treatment of CTO, which is relative feasible, and has a high success rate. Epicardial CCs injury can be safety as long as it is treated timely. 展开更多

Heat transfer experiments were conducted to investigate the thermal performance of air cooling through mini-channel heat sink with various configurations. Two types of channels have been used, one has a rectangular cross section area of 5 × 18 mm2 and the other is triangular with dimension of 5 × 9 mm2. Four channels of each configuration have been etched on copper block of 40 mm width,30 mm height, and 200 mm length. The measurements were performed in steady state with air flow rates of 0.002 - 0.005 m3/s, heating powers of 80 - 200 W and channel base temperatures of 48°C, 51°C, 55°C and 60°C. The results showed that the heat transfer to air stream is increased with increasing both of air mass flow rate and channel base temperature. The rectangular channels have better thermal performance than trian- gular ones at the same conditions. Analytical fin approach of 1-D and 2-D model were used to predict the heat transfer rate and outlet air temperature from channels heat sink. Theoretical results have been compared with experimental data. The predicted values for outlet air temperatures using the two models agree well with a deviation less than ±10%. But for the heat transfer data, the deviation is about +30% to –60% for 1-D model, and –5% to –80% for 2-D model. The global Nusselt number of the present experimental data is empirically correlated as with accuracy of ±20% for and compared with other literature correlations. 展开更多

A multiuser Ultra Wide Band (UWB) channel suffers seriously from realistic impairments. Among this, multipath fading and interferences, such as Multiple Access Interference (MAI) and Inter Symbol Interference (ISI), that significantly degrade the system performance. In this paper, a polar coding technique, originally developed by Arikan, is suggested to enhance the BER performance of indoor UWB based Orthogonal Frequency Division Multiplexing (OFDM) communications. Moreover, Interleave Division Multiple Access (IDMA) scheme has been considered for multiuser detection depending on the turbo type Chip-By-Chip (CBC) iterative detection strategy. Three different models as Symmetric Alpha Stable (SαS), Laplace model and Gaussian Mixture Model (GMM), have been introduced for approximating the interferences which are more realistic for UWB system. The performance of the proposed Polar-coded IDMA OFDM-based UWB system is investigated under UWB channel models proposed by IEEE 802.15.3a working group and compared with Low Density Parity Check (LDPC)-coded IDMA OFDM-based UWB system in terms of BER performance and complexity under the studied noise models. Simulation results show that the complexity of the proposed polar-coded system is much lower than LDPC-coded system with minor performance degradation. Furthermore, the proposed polar-coded system is robust against noise and interferences in UWB indoor environment and gains a significant performance improvement by about 5 dB compared with un-coded IDMA-OFDM-UWB system under the studied noise models. 展开更多
